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9256117 962 74116533107 85486
6747192253 7157640 339
6747192253 7157640 339
26197200 727573 507894
All about undefined
Interested in learning more?
6747192253 7157640 339
26197200 727573 507894
See more
79723 648017
27711404 045269229 9173528412
See more
70 4885623
29 94936760 2188810 36
See more